An antibody specific for EFEMP2 has been pre-coated onto a microplate. Standards and samples are pipetted into the wells and anyEFEMP2 present is bound by the immobilized antibody. After removing any unbound substances, a biotin-conjµgated antibody specific for EFEMP2 is added to the wells. After washing, Streptavidin conjµgated Horseradish Peroxidase (HRP) is added to the wells. Following a wash to remove any unbound avidin-enzyme reagent, a substrate solution is added to the wells and color develops in proportion to the amount of EFEMP2 bound in the initial step. The color development is stopped and the intensity of the color is measured. Product Overview:A large number of extracellµLar matrix proteins have been found to contain variations of the epidermal growth factor (EGF) domain and have been implicated in functions as diverse as blood coagµLation, activation of complement and determination of cell fate during development. FBLN4 contains four EGF2 domains and six calcium-binding EGF2 domains. This gene is necessary for elastic fiber formation and connective tissue development. Defects in this gene are cause of an autosomal recessive cutis laxa syndrome.EFEMP1 is likewise expressed in a wide range of adµLt and fetal tissues. In contrast to EFEMP1, however, EFEMP2 was not significantly overexpressed in senescent or quiescent fibroblasts, sµggesting a diversity of function within this EGF-like domain subfamily. Stability:The stability of ELISA kit is determined by the loss rate of activity. The loss rate of this kit is less than 5% within the expiration date under appropriate storage condition. The loss rate was determined by accelerated thermal degradation test. Keep the kit at 37°C for 4 and 7 days, and compare O.D.values of the kit kept at 37°C with that of at recommended temperature. (referring from China Biological Products Standard, which was calcµLated by the Arrhenius equation. For ELISA kit, 4 days storage at 37°C can be considered as 6 months at 2 - 8°C, which means 7 days at 37°C equaling 12 months at 2 - 8°C).
